Hi Iming,
the matching process uses Zebra to find the right match. 997$c has to be indexed for this to work and the index name needs to be added to your matching rule configuration.
Also I think you need to have all subfields for an item in one single 952 field in order for the items to be imported correctly.

Subject: [Koha] Import holdings as a separate file to MARC bib. records
Dear all,
I have successfully migrated MARC bib. records from our old system to Koha 3.12. The old system can only export holdings (items) in csv format, which I have successfully converted to MARC with Koha 952 tags (using MarcEdit). A few examples below:
=LDR 00292nam a2200145Ia 45e0 =008 130605s9999\\\\xx\\\\\\\\\\\\000\0\und\d =952 \\$2ddc =952 \\$aCPL =952 \\$bCPL =952 \\$g7.95 =952 \\$o423.1 MACQ =952 \\$p30094000001781 =952 \\$tIn Manager's Office =952 \\$yBK =997 \\$c26
=LDR 00278nam a2200145Ia 45e0 =008 130605s9999\\\\xx\\\\\\\\\\\\000\0\und\d =952 \\$2ddc =952 \\$71 =952 \\$aMPL =952 \\$bMPL =952 \\$g72.50 =952 \\$oLS 025.32 ANG =952 \\$p30094000002920 =952 \\$yBK =997 \\$c51
=LDR 00278nam a2200145Ia 45e0 =008 130605s9999\\\\xx\\\\\\\\\\\\000\0\und\d =952 \\$2ddc =952 \\$aMPL =952 \\$bMPL =952 \\$g0.00 =952 \\$oPER 051 REA =952 \\$p10000032 =952 \\$t1999 Sept. =952 \\$yBK =997 \\$c78
=LDR 00277nam a2200145Ia 45e0 =008 130605s9999\\\\xx\\\\\\\\\\\\000\0\und\d =952 \\$2ddc =952 \\$aMPL =952 \\$bMPL =952 \\$g0.00 =952 \\$oPER 051 REA =952 \\$p10000033 =952 \\$t1999 Oct. =952 \\$yBK =997 \\$c78
Our old system Control Number is stored on 997$c tag and this number is also found in each of our holdings record. So it is logical to match holdings to bibliographic records using 997$c tag (instead of the ISBN 020$a or ISSN 022$a). So I have setup a new matching rule using 997$c in our Koha system. However, after I imported the holdings MARC file to the reservoir using the Staged MARC Import function, it informed me that no matches were found (when I have selected 997$c as the match point)!
Have I missed something? Your assistance will be greatly appreciated.
